The AAQ invites its members to take note of the launch of the 2024-2025 cycle of UNESCO's Memory of the World Program:

The Canadian Commission for UNESCO and the Memory of the World Advisory Committee are pleased to launch their 2024-2025 cycle.

The Memory of the World Program is a national and international commemorative designation recognizing significant examples of documentary heritage, including single items or entire fonds and collections. Collections that have been recognized in the past include the archives of the National Center for Truth and Reconciliation, the Viola Desmond Court Archive, and the archives of Doctors Banting and Best concerning the discovery of insulin.

This year, the Memory of the World Committee is particularly interested in nationally significant archival collections relating to science, technology, engineering and mathematics. This special theme does not preclude the nomination of other documents, fonds or collections of national importance.

The call for nominations is now open. The deadline for submitting expressions of interest is January 31, 2025.
